阿里云文章

阿里云ECS使用OSS

阿里云ECS(Elastic Compute Service)是阿里云提供的一种弹性计算服务,可以帮助用户快速部署和管理云服务器。而OSS(Object Storage Service)是阿里云提供的对象存储服务,可以用来存储和管理大量的非结构化数据。

通过将阿里云ECS和OSS相结合,用户可以实现在云服务器上直接访问、上传、下载和管理OSS中存储的文件。这种集成可以带来许多好处。首先,用户可以将静态文件(如图片、文档、音频、视频等)存储在OSS中,从而减轻ECS上的存储压力。其次,OSS提供了高可靠性和强大的扩展性,可以满足用户对数据存储和传输的需求。最重要的是,通过使用OSS,用户可以实现跨区域备份和容灾,提高数据的安全性和可靠性。

阿里云ECS与OSS的集成非常简单。首先,用户需要在阿里云控制台上创建一个OSS Bucket,用来存储文件。然后,在ECS实例上安装OSS的SDK和相应的访问密钥。接下来,用户可以使用SDK提供的API来访问OSS中的文件,实现文件的上传、下载和管理。此外,阿里云还提供了一些便捷工具,例如OSSFS(OSS File System),用户可以将OSS Bucket挂载到ECS实例上,像访问本地文件系统一样操作OSS中的文件。

除了使用SDK和工具,用户还可以通过使用ECS实例的内网IP和OSS内网Endpoint来实现更快速和更安全的访问。通过内网访问,用户可以节约网络带宽和流量费用,提高访问速度和稳定性。此外,阿里云还提供了VPC(Virtual Private Cloud)网络,可以实现ECS实例和OSS之间的私有网络连接,提供更高的安全性和隔离性。

总之,阿里云ECS与OSS的集成可以帮助用户更好地利用云计算和云存储的优势。通过将静态文件存储在OSS中,可以减轻ECS上的存储压力,并实现跨区域备份和容灾,提高数据的安全性和可靠性。而通过使用SDK、工具和内网访问,用户可以更方便、快速和安全地访问和管理OSS中的文件。阿里云的ECS和OSS提供了强大的计算和存储能力,为用户的业务提供了可靠的基础设施。